The formula to calculate the angle θ from the x-axis is:
θ = arctan(y/x)
Where x and y are the coordinates, and arctan is the inverse tangent function.
Real-World Examples
- Case 1: If x = 3 and y = 4, then θ = arctan(4/3) ≈ 53.13°.
- Case 2: If x = -2 and y = 1, then θ = arctan(1/-2) ≈ -26.57° (positive angle is 153.43°).
- Case 3: If x = 0 and y = 5, then θ = arctan(5/0) is undefined (vertical line).
